What companies run services between Paignton, England and Exeter services, England?
Great Western Railway (GWR) operates a train from Paignton to Digby & Sowton hourly. Tickets cost £9–20 and the journey takes 1h 12m. Alternatively, National Express operates a bus from Great Western Road to Bampfylde Street every 3 hours. Tickets cost £6–11 and the journey takes 1h 25m.
